About the Song
"Intuition" is a dance-pop song written and produced by American singer-songwriter Jewel and songwriter-producer Lester Mendez for Jewel's fourth studio album, 0304 (2003). It was released as the album's lead single in May 2003. Following the club success of "Serve the Ego", Jewel moved to a more pop-oriented sound with the release of "Intuition". The song, which strays from her usual folk style with simple acoustic guitar instrumentation, starts off with a French accordion and then experiments with pop beats with subtle urban influences, using synthesizers. The song achieved moderate success in the United States, reaching number twenty on the Billboard Hot 100. However, a number of Jewel's fans criticized her for abandoning her traditional folk style in exchange for a new pop sound. About the Artist
Jewel Kilcher (born May 23; 1974) is an American singer; songwriter; actress; and poet; generally known just by her first name; Jewel. She has received three Grammy Award nominations and sold over 27 million albums worldwide.She debuted on February 28; 1995 with the album; Pieces of You; which became one of the best selling debut albums of all time; going platinum twelve times.
